Best Times to Visit Kazawa Onsen

When should you plan your Vacation Rentals stay?

To fully enjoy the soothing hot springs experience here, consider planning your trip during the region's quieter seasons or shoulder periods when the area offers a more tranquil and authentic ambiance for your stay.

Peak Season Highlights

spring
Spring (March to May)

During this time, you can enjoy the region’s beautiful cherry blossoms and mild weather, making it ideal for exploring and relaxing in your vacation rental. The temperatures are comfortable, encouraging outdoor activities.

Average Temperature Daytime: 12°C to 18°C - Nighttime: 4°C to 8°C
autumn
Autumn (September to November)

This is a popular season for experiencing vibrant fall foliage, which enhances the natural beauty of the area. The weather remains pleasant, perfect for enjoying the hot springs and scenic views from your vacation rental.

Average Temperature Daytime: 10°C to 16°C - Nighttime: 3°C to 7°C

Off-Season Highlights

image
Winter (December to February)

While colder, winter offers a serene atmosphere with opportunities for enjoying snow-covered landscapes and hot springs. Your vacation rental can provide a cozy retreat during these months.

Average Temperature Daytime: -2°C to 4°C - Nighttime: -8°C to -2°C
image
Summer (June to August)

In the summer, the region experiences warm weather and lush greenery, making it suitable for outdoor exploration and relaxation in your vacation rental. It’s a quiet time to visit if you prefer fewer crowds.

Average Temperature Daytime: 20°C to 25°C - Nighttime: 12°C to 17°C

Transportation Options

  • Train: You can take the Nagano Shinkansen to Ueda Station, providing a quick and comfortable way to reach the area from major Japanese cities.
  • Bus: Local buses connect Kazawa Onsen with nearby towns and attractions, offering an economical transportation option for exploring the region.
  • Car Rental: Renting a car provides the flexibility to discover scenic spots and hidden gems around Ueda and the surrounding countryside at your own pace.
  • Taxi: Taxi services are readily available in the area, offering convenient point-to-point transportation without the need for public transit schedules.

Local Customs Options

  • Respect for Bathing Etiquette: In this area, communal onsen baths are an essential part of local culture, and observing proper etiquette, such as cleansing before entering and maintaining quiet, ensures a respectful experience for all visitors.
  • Traditional Dress Codes: When participating in local customs, wearing yukata or modest attire is common during festival events or visits to shrines, reflecting the region’s appreciation for tradition.
  • Politeness and Bowing: Greeting locals with a bow and displaying courteous manners are highly valued here, fostering warm interactions and showing respect for the area's cultural norms.
  • Seasonal Festivals and Rituals: Engaging in regional festivals and seasonal rituals provides an authentic way to connect with local traditions and appreciate the region's rich cultural heritage.
